Job Description: The Registered Nurse (RN) position is responsible for providing nursing services to clients/patients in a variety of settings to include but not limited to: residential care facilities, behavioral health programs, substance use disorder treatment programs, crisis centers, outpatient and/or primary medical care clinics or in the community within client/patient homes. - Perform all appropriate nursing assessments per service line requirements, utilizing a high level of clinical competence.
- Evaluate the client/patient's physical condition and the need for services.
- Complete required screenings, record the client/patient's initial medical histories and vital signs; coordinate any required action planning based on results.
- Monitor the health status of the client/patient during services provided.
- Work with the treatment team to coordinate care based on client/patient needs.
- Create action plans for client/patient based on physical and mental health in regards to treatment needs.
- Oversee infectious disease control, client/patient hygiene, and related client & facility health issues, under the supervision of nursing leadership.
- Provide disease prevention, risk reduction and other health education as needed.
- Arrange medical appointments for client/patients dealing with medical conditions that occur during treatment and manage medical emergencies, such as accidental injuries and/or drug reactions.
- Consult with a physician/advanced practice provider as necessary or advocate for medical services through managed care organizations.
- Arrange or monitor special dietary needs for medical conditions.
- Review medication requirements with clients/patients, educating the client and guardian (if necessary) about the benefits of taking prescribed medications as prescribed.
- Administer and oversee administration of medications via various methods according to service line requirements; Monitor medication compliance in regard to State Regulatory standards.
- Consult with the physician/advanced practice provider or pharmacy to confirm medications prescribed.
- Oversee therapeutic injection of medication (subcutaneous or intramuscular).
- Monitor lab levels including consultation with physicians/advanced practice providers, clients, and clinical staff.
- Coordinate medication needs with pharmacies, clients/patients, and families, including the use of indigent drug programs.
- Monitor medication side-effects including the use of standardized evaluations.
- Monitor physician orders for treatment modifications requiring client/patient education.
- Assists Physician/Advanced Practice Provider with client/patient exams.
- Sets up and draws any necessary labs and performs any special procedures as requested by the Physician/Advanced Practice Provider.
